11-1, WX8, 1911 U.S. Red Cross Christmas Seal, Type 2, VF, full gum, MNH. Designed by Anton Rudert. Issued 1911 by the American National Red Cross. There were five types of 1911 Christmas TB Seals. This is the Type 2. Image of a house within heavy red circle.
The 1911 Type 2 Christmas Seal has a circular frame 22mm in diameter, the house is green shaded with white lines, and red windows, and a thinner red circle.

Typographed by Eureka Specialty Printing Co., perf. 12.
Christmas Seals are also known as TB Charity Seals, and are usually classified as Charity Seals, or Cinderella Stamps.
